Dr. Khawaja Amir Mahmood is a highly experienced general physician with over 18 years of medical practice. Known for his patient-focused care and diagnostic accuracy, he has successfully managed a wide range of acute and chronic medical conditions, including hypertension, diabetes, infections, and respiratory illnesses. He provides both in-person consultations and online video appointments, ensuring accessible care to patients across Multan and surrounding areas. Dr. Mahmood continues to build trust in the community through his dedication to preventive healthcare, health counseling, and evidence-based general medicine.
